Grandview Avenue Valve Replacements#
The 1920s lines and valves were replaced in three phases, completing a project that was ongoing since 2008.
Finishing this project enhanced water service reliability and safety in the area and coincided with Laporte Avenue repaving that was completed later in the summer.
Key Facts and Timeline#
These custom-built water valves from the 1920s were removed and new valves were installed during this project.
Water rehabilitation work was completed in three phases over the summer of 2014.
Phase 1: Taft Hill Waterline Replacement.
Phase 2: Pipeline Replacement at Grandview Avenue.
Phase 3: Major Valve Replacements at the intersection of Laporte and Grandview Avenue.
